Mempelajari pemrograman sistem operasi merupakan hal yang sangat penting bagi para pengembang perangkat lunak. Sebagai seorang spesialis dalam bidang ini, Anda akan memiliki pengetahuan dan keterampilan yang dibutuhkan untuk membuat sistem operasi yang efisien dan handal. Dalam blog post ini, kita akan membahas beberapa langkah yang dapat Anda ambil untuk menjadi seorang spesialis dalam pemrograman sistem operasi.
Langkah 1: Pelajari Dasar-dasar Pemrograman
Langkah pertama untuk menjadi spesialis dalam pemrograman sistem operasi adalah memahami dasar-dasar pemrograman. Pelajari bahasa pemrograman seperti C, C++, atau Java, yang sering digunakan dalam pengembangan sistem operasi. Anda juga perlu memahami konsep dasar pemrograman seperti variabel, loop, dan fungsi. Tanpa pemahaman dasar ini, sulit bagi Anda untuk memahami sistem operasi secara keseluruhan.
Langkah 2: Pahami Struktur Sistem Operasi
Setelah Anda memahami dasar-dasar pemrograman, langkah selanjutnya adalah memahami struktur sistem operasi. Pelajari bagaimana sistem operasi bekerja, mulai dari manajemen memori hingga manajemen proses. Pahami juga konsep-konsep seperti system calls, interrupt, dan device drivers. Semakin banyak Anda memahami struktur sistem operasi, semakin baik Anda dalam mengembangkan sistem operasi yang efisien.
Langkah 3: Praktikkan Pengembangan Sistem Operasi
Salah satu cara terbaik untuk menjadi spesialis dalam pemrograman sistem operasi adalah dengan mempraktikkan pengembangan sistem operasi. Mulailah dengan membuat proyek kecil seperti membuat bootloader atau file system sederhana. Kemudian, tingkatkan kompleksitas proyek Anda seiring berjalannya waktu. Dengan melakukan praktik ini, Anda akan belajar banyak tentang bagaimana sistem operasi bekerja secara langsung.
Langkah 4: Terus Belajar dan Berkolaborasi dengan Profesional
Untuk terus menjadi spesialis dalam pemrograman sistem operasi, Anda perlu terus belajar dan mengikuti perkembangan terbaru dalam bidang ini. Ikuti seminar, workshop, atau kursus pemrograman sistem operasi yang dapat meningkatkan pengetahuan dan keterampilan Anda. Selain itu, jangan ragu untuk berkolaborasi dengan para profesional dalam bidang ini. Dengan berdiskusi dan bertukar informasi, Anda dapat memperluas wawasan dan meningkatkan kemampuan Anda dalam pemrograman sistem operasi.
Dengan mengikuti langkah-langkah di atas, Anda dapat menjadi seorang spesialis dalam pemrograman sistem operasi. Pemahaman yang mendalam tentang dasar-dasar pemrograman, struktur sistem operasi, serta praktik pengembangan sistem operasi akan membantu Anda menjadi ahli dalam bidang ini. Jangan ragu untuk terus belajar dan berkolaborasi dengan profesional untuk terus meningkatkan kemampuan Anda dalam pemrograman sistem operasi.
Jangan lupa untuk meninggalkan komentar di bawah ini jika Anda memiliki pertanyaan atau ingin berbagi pengalaman Anda dalam mempelajari pemrograman sistem operasi. Terima kasih!